“Meet Me on South Street: The Story of JC Dobbs” Screening

Vinyl Revival continues its indie film screening series, First Friday Flicks in association withFirstGlance Film Festival, in its Vault theater with “Meet Me on South Street:  The Story of JC Dobbs” by George Manney on Friday, March 7th at 7:00 p.m.  First Friday Flicks will also screen on Saturdays each month at 2 p.m.  Tickets are $8, $5 for students and seniors. Screening events are BYOB and snacks.

“Meet Me On South Street: The Story of JC Dobbs” documents the evolution of Philly’s fertile music and arts subculture in the 1970′s until the sad closing of JC Dobbs in 1996.  With archival photographs, videos and contemporary interviews, George Manney recreates the rich history of Philadelphia’s premiere rock and roll bar.  “Meet Me On South Street: The Story of JC Dobbs” stars Stephen Caldwell from The OrlonsTommy ConwellGreg Davis fromBeru RevueCyndy DrueAndre GardnerGeorge Thorogood & The DestroyersCharlie GracieRobert Hazard & many more!
